This is the original RKO titles to Pluto’s Blue Note, the last Disney cartoon to be released in 1947, scanned from a 16mm blue-track Technicolor print. In addition to the credits having the expected layout of the time, the title card is noticably different from the Buena Vista reissue. The reissue kept the background art, but the lettering was condensed to vertically place the title closer to the centre – at a safe distance from TV or 16mm cropping. The original title card can also be seen in the Disneyland episode At Home with Donald Duck.
